Comprehending Common Conservatory Issues
Before diving into the repair procedure, it's important to comprehend the common issues that conservatories face. These can range from minor cosmetic issues to more substantial structural concerns. Here are a few of the most regular issues:
Leaking Roofs and Windows
Causes: Poor sealing, RepairMyWindowsAndDoors damaged glazing, or worn-out rubber gaskets.Signs: Water discolorations on the ceiling, dampness, or puddles on the flooring.
Structural Damage
Causes: Age, weather exposure, or bad installation.Signs: Cracks in the frame, loose panels, or creaking noises.
Condensation
Causes: Insufficient ventilation, poor insulation, or high humidity.Signs: Foggy windows, damp surfaces, and mold development.
Fading or Discoloration
Causes: UV direct exposure, harsh weather, or low-quality products.Signs: Yellowing of the frame, peeling paint, or blemished glass.
Faulty Doors and Windows

Regular Inspections
Conduct a thorough inspection of your conservatory at least twice a year. Examine for any signs of damage, wear, or degeneration.
Check Seals and Gaskets
Examine the seals around windows and doors. Change any that are cracked, worn, or no longer supply a tight seal.
Examine Structural Integrity
Try to find any signs of structural damage, such as cracks or loose panels. If you see any issues, it's important to resolve them quickly to prevent more damage.
Evaluate Insulation and Ventilation
Make sure that your conservatory has appropriate insulation and ventilation. Poor insulation can result in condensation and energy loss, while inadequate ventilation can trigger wetness and mold growth.
Clean and Maintain

Roof and Window Leaks
Immediate Action: Place pails or towels to capture water and avoid damage to the flooring.Long-Term Solution: Re-seal or replace damaged glazing and rubber gaskets. Think about using a top quality sealant created for conservatories.
Structural Repairs
Immediate Action: Secure any loose panels or frames to avoid further damage.Long-Term Solution: Consult a professional to evaluate the extent of the damage and suggest the best course of action. This may consist of reinforcing the structure or replacing damaged components.
Condensation Management
Immediate Action: Use dehumidifiers or fans to reduce wetness levels.Long-Term Solution: Install additional ventilation, such as drip vents or a mechanical ventilation system. Think about upgrading to double or triple-glazed windows for better insulation.
Fading and Discoloration
Immediate Action: Apply a protective finishing to the impacted areas.Long-Term Solution: Replace any significantly damaged or stained parts. Choose premium, UV-resistant materials for future setups.
Faulty Doors and Windows

While many conservatory repairs can be handled by homeowners, there are times when professional assistance is required. Here are some scenarios where it's best to contact an expert:

Q: How often should I inspect my conservatory?A: It's advised to inspect your conservatory at least two times a year, ideally in the spring and fall, to catch any issues before they become significant problems.
Q: Can I fix a leaking roof myself?A: Minor leaks can often be fixed with a great sealant, however more considerable issues might require professional assistance to ensure the repair is efficient and lasting.
Q: What can I do to avoid condensation in my conservatory?A: Improving ventilation and insulation are key. Consider setting up trickle vents, using dehumidifiers, and updating to double or triple-glazed windows.
Q: How do I select the best products for my conservatory repair?A: Look for top quality, UV-resistant materials that appropriate for the specific conditions of your conservatory. Talk to a professional to guarantee you make the best options.
Q: Is it cost-effective to repair a conservatory, or should I consider replacing it?A: The cost-effectiveness of repair versus replacement depends upon the extent of the damage. Small repairs are typically more cost-effective, however if the damage is extensive, replacement might be the better long-term solution.
